Da Vinci show at the Houston Museum of Natural Science

July 13th, 2008 · No Comments

click on photos for larger views:

You’d think it wouldn’t be possible to learn more about Da Vinci, science majors cover him well. But I discovered a sketch of his at the show I’d never seen before, it was totally surreal and Dali like. I’ll have to look it up. It’s the sketch in the photo gallery here.

The exhibit was mostly smaller working models of several of his inventions and I had a really hard time not taking them all apart, putting them back together and playing with them all.

A good, not a great show, worth seeing if you are going to be a the museum, probably not worth a trip on its own.
